iPod Integration - Bluetooh Adapter
Good morning all,
My 07 IS350 has a iPod integration kit (30 pin connection) that is completely useless to me since I own a android. I purchased a bluetooth adapter (see link below) as an attempt to avoid using a wired AUX coord to stream music from my phone. However, the iPod integration is smarter than I had anticipated and knows that the bluetooth adapter is not an Apple product so it won't play any music
Has anyone found a bluetooth adapter for their iPod integration kit that tricks the system into think the adapter is an apple product?

I got the original Blackberry Remote Stereo Gateway for Bluetooth streaming. (Don't get the new Music Gateway; it significantly decreases the volume and bass). It uses the AUX port and can be conveniently hidden in the front armrest console. It also requires a separate USB car charger for power using a USB to USB Mini B cable. It comes with a cable, but it stuck up too much for me to close the armrest so I recommend getting a 90* cable. You also might need a ground loop isolator to prevent humming that changes pitch as the RPMs change.

Thanks for the responses. Actually I am using a bluetooth AUX audio integration as you both have mentioned and it works fine minus the following:
1. It hums with the usb charger and AUX. When I had the ground loop isolator it deteriorated the sound quality significantly.
2. I'm looking for a system that powers on when i start the car. I currently have to power my bluetooth AUX manually when I enter the car.
The bluetooth AUX is a minor inconvenience but I'll deal with it if it is the best option I have until i can figure something else out.
